Abstract

This paper, which continued the preceding works, will provide further detailed discussions about both parasitic hunting-effect alleviation of transverse flux homopolar linear induction machine (TFLIM), and improvement on closed-loop transient characteristics of transverse flux homopolar linear oscillating machine (TFLOM). Novel artificial knowledge-based compensators are proposed here to solve above problems for these time-varying and highly nonlinear machine systems. It will be shown that not only this approach is easy of practical implementation, but also the involved design tasks of such compensators are applicable for other linear machine control objectives. Illustrations and verifications will be supplied to confirm the graceful features of this intelligent strategy. Keywords: linear induction machine, linear oscillating machine, hunting effect, fuzzy logic, knowledge-based strategy.
